Is swearing falsely by Allah—with the intention of escaping a specific situation—considered an oath that incurs damnation (yamin ghamus), and what is its expiation?
Source: FtawySummarized from the full answer at Ftawy · imported Sep 2, 2026
Your oath is a yameen ghamus, which is one of the major sins. The majority of scholars hold that there is no expiation for it except repentance, but it is more cautious to offer the expiation for an oath to avoid scholarly disagreement.
You must repent to Allah Almighty for swearing a false oath to please a created being. You must also avoid relationships between men and women online and repent for what has occurred through them, as they contain impermissible aspects.
